WHO IS IT that will offer up unto God a goodly loan, which He will amply repay For, such [as do so] shall have a noble reward 11 On that day you will see the faithful men and the faithful women-- their light running before them and on their right hand-- good news for you today: gardens beneath which rivers flow, to abide therein, that is the grand achievement. 12 On that Day shall the hypocrites, both men and women, speak [thus] unto those who have attained to faith: "Wait for us! Let us have a [ray of] light from your light!" [But] they will be told: "Turn back, and seek a light [of your own]!" And thereupon a wall will be raised between them [and the believers,] with a gate in it: within it will be grace and mercy, and against the outside thereof, suffering. 13 They will cry unto them: have we not been with you? They will say: yea! but ye tempted your souls, and ye waited, and ye dubitated, and your vain desires beguiled you until the affair of Allah came, and in respect to Allah the beguiler beguiled you. 14 So no ransom shall be accepted from you today, nor from those who disbelieved. You are destined for the Fire. That will be your guardian. And that indeed is a grievous destination. 15 ۞ Has not the Time arrived for the Believers that their hearts in all humility should engage in the remembrance of Allah and of the Truth which has been revealed (to them), and that they should not become like those to whom was given Revelation aforetime, but long ages passed over them and their hearts grew hard? For many among them are rebellious transgressors. 16 Know well that Allah revives the earth after it becomes lifeless. We have clearly shown Our Signs to you, perchance you will use your reason. 17 Surely those, the men and the women, who make freewill offerings and have lent to God a good loan, it shall be multiplied for them, and theirs shall be a generous wage. 18 And those who believe in Allah and all His Noble Messengers, are the truly sincere; and are witness upon others, before their Lord; for them is their reward, and their light; and those who disbelieved and denied Our signs, are the people of hell. 19
